Multiple associations, endless exploitations

Th e motive behind the formation of trade associations is still obscure.

Th eir formation appears to be shrouded by some ulterior and selfi sh motives, including fi nancial aggrandizement.

Most of these associations claim to be fi ghting the cause of their members, but their activities reveal that they are doing the exact opposite.

If they were truly interested in the welfare of their members, why do they force some members who are not willing to join into the associations? Th e truth is that the founders of these associations enrich themselves while the members suff er.

Th ey are more or less reaping the eff orts of many industrious entrepreneurs by engaging them in activities that rip them off eventually.

Of great concern is the fact that these associations form a pillar behind the skyrocketing prices of commodities and services in Nigeria.

Th ey control the prices of the goods and services produced by their members.

Th is is to increase their prospects of prosperity and progress without a consideration for their hapless members.

But there are millions of Nigerians who cannot aff ord basic needs because of the unscrupulous increase in the prices of commodities.

Th ese associations should know that membership of any association should be based on free will and interest, not coercion, if they really mean to fi ght for the interests of Nigerian entrepreneurs.

I do not seek to attack anybody, but to correct some of the anomalies in our dear country.
